- 1Какие возможности даёт PHP; преимущества перед другими языками и почему стоит выбрать его; что будет на курсе: рассматриваем план курса, какой результат мы получим, чему научимся.Урок 1. Для чего нужен PHP
- 2Как взаимодействуют между собой веб-сервер, PHP интерпретатор и база данных; качаем готовую сборку Open Server; выбираем версию PHP; выбираем версию apache; настраиваем доступ к локальному сайту; как понять, что всё настроено правильно и работает; используем редактор кода Sublime Text, встроенный в сборку Open Server.Урок 2. Установка и развертывание сервера на своем компьютере
- 3Кратко рассматриваем для чего нужен html; рассматриваем основные теги: doctype, html, head, title, body, header, h1, footer, div, a, img и их место в веб-странице; демонстрируем, как работают эти теги; показываем созданные теги в панели «Инструменты разработчика» в Google Chrome; создаём ссылки на главную страницу и страницу с магазином так, чтобы можно было перейти в магазин и обратно.Урок 3. Как создавать веб-страницы
- 4Рассматриваем CSS: что это такое, как подключить стили к странице; пишем хедер и рассматриваем, как его оформить с помощью CSS.Урок 4. Создаём макет нашего магазина
- 5Заканчиваем писать хедер; добавляем оставшиеся части макета из готового шаблона; переносим необходимые части макета из готового шаблона (HTML, CSS, JavaScript).Урок 5. Завершаем оформление шаблона
- 6Как использовать PHP в нашем шаблоне; для чего нужны переменные и как с ними работать; какие типы данных есть в PHP, для чего они нужны.Урок 6. Основы PHP
- 7Для чего нужны массивы и как их использовать; кладём информацию о товаре в массив.Урок 7. Как хранить множество связанных данных
- 8Вложенные массивы; размещаем данные для нашего магазина во вложенных массивах; как получить информацию о товаре из вложенного массива.Урок 8. Хранение и обработка связанных по смыслу данных
- 9Что делать, если нужно вывести на страницу много данных из массива.Урок 9. Работаем с циклами
- 10Как сделать так, чтобы программа меняла поведение в зависимости от разных условий; как понять, какую страницу нужно открыть; используем параметры адресной строки для открытия нужной страницы.Урок 10. Как сделать сайт живым
- 11Делаем ссылки на другие страницы; организуем удобную структуру шаблона; выносим отдельные части шаблона в другие файлы; подключаем другие страницы в зависимости от параметров в адресной строке.Урок 11. Как делать навигацию между страницами
- 12Вывод всех товаров на страницу; работаем со страницей товара; как в каталоге товаров создавать правильные ссылки для каждого товара; выводим данные о товаре на отдельной странице.Урок 12. Создаём каталог товаров
- 13Регистрируем имя для нашего сайта; загружаем файлы на хостинг и проверяем работоспособность сайта.Урок 13. Размещаем сайт в интернете
После обучения мы предлагаем всем выпускникам оценить программу курса и преподавателя, а также при желании оставить отзыв.
Все отзывы и оценки мы публикуем без изменений.